Being a Field Consultant is an exciting opportunity to consult with new and existing franchisees while promoting the growth and development of Kumon Centres. As a Field Consultant you will partner with franchisees to achieve Centre goals relating to student enrollment, retention, student achievement, market penetration, and profitability.
Responsibilities:
- Oversee roughly 25-35 locations
- Act as a partner with Franchisees to develop their business
- Perform frequent evaluations and follow up visits to ensure compliance with company goals
- Increase operations standards through guidance and training
- Provide sound advice to increase Centre profitability and performance
- Assess regional market conditions to ensure competitiveness and build brand awareness
- Evaluate local competition and create branch level strategies for franchisees to maintain a competitive edge
- Consistently monitors branch and center level performance for trends, outliers, and best practices
- Assist Franchisees with all aspects of new center opening process within predetermined timeline
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ree required
- Road Warrior, up to 60% travel is required. Ability to travel extensively locally/regionally throughout Ontario.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Passion for continuously developing and learning
- Strong time management and prioritization skills
- Ability to motivate people, instill accountability, and achieve results
- Proficiency with Word and Excel software programs
- Previous Multi-Unit service management considered an asset
- Prior P&L responsibility a plus
